Understanding Your Denture Options

Dentures come in different types, each designed to suit various needs. The main types include:

1. Full Dentures

Full dentures, also known as complete dentures, are designed for individuals who have lost all their teeth in either the upper or lower jaw (or both). These dentures are custom-made to fit comfortably over your gums and provide a natural-looking smile. Full dentures are ideal for those seeking a complete dental restoration.

2. Partial Dentures

If you still have some natural teeth remaining, partial dentures may be a suitable option. These dentures consist of replacement teeth attached to a gum-coloured base and are supported by a metal or flexible framework. Partial dentures help maintain alignment by preventing remaining teeth from shifting.

3. Implant-Supported Dentures

Implant-supported dentures offer a more secure and long-lasting alternative to traditional dentures. They are anchored by dental implants surgically placed into the jawbone, providing superior stability and a more natural feel. These dentures are perfect for those who want added security and the ability to eat and speak comfortably without worrying about slippage.

4. Flexible Dentures

Made from a softer and more flexible material than traditional dentures, flexible dentures provide enhanced comfort and durability. They are lightweight and adapt well to the natural shape of your gums, making them an excellent option for those with sensitive mouths or those who find rigid dentures uncomfortable.

Factors to Consider When Choosing Your Dentures

Selecting the right dentures involves considering your lifestyle, comfort preferences, and long-term needs. Here are some key factors to keep in mind:

1. Comfort and Fit

A well-fitting denture ensures comfort and functionality. Poorly fitted dentures can cause irritation, sore spots, and difficulty eating or speaking. When selecting your dentures, work closely with your dentist to ensure they are properly tailored to your mouth’s shape and structure.

2. Durability and Longevity

If you lead an active lifestyle and need durable dentures, implant-supported or flexible dentures may be the best choice. These options offer increased stability and resistance to breakage compared to traditional acrylic dentures.

3. Aesthetics and Natural Appearance

Your smile is an essential part of your identity. Modern dentures are designed to look incredibly natural, mimicking the appearance of real teeth. If aesthetics are a priority, high-quality materials and custom shading will help create a seamless, natural look.

4. Eating and Speaking

Some dentures allow for better chewing efficiency and clearer speech. Implant-supported dentures and well-fitted partials tend to provide better control when eating and speaking. If you enjoy a varied diet, opt for a secure and stable denture option.

5. Maintenance and Hygiene

Different types of dentures require different levels of care. Traditional full and partial dentures need to be removed and cleaned daily, while implant-supported dentures can often be treated similarly to natural teeth. Consider your ability to maintain proper hygiene when choosing a denture type.

6. Budget and Cost Considerations

The cost of dentures varies depending on the type, material, and additional treatments required. While traditional full or partial dentures are more affordable upfront, implant-supported dentures are a long-term investment that offers enhanced stability and functionality. Discuss pricing options with your dentist to find a solution that fits your budget.

Adjusting to Life with Dentures

Once you’ve chosen your dentures, there is an adjustment period as you get used to wearing them. Here are some tips to help you transition smoothly:

  • Practice Speaking – Reading aloud and practising difficult words can help you adjust to speaking with your new dentures.
  • Eat Soft Foods First – Start with soft foods and gradually introduce tougher textures as you become more comfortable.
  • Maintain Proper Cleaning – Keep your dentures clean by following your dentist’s recommended hygiene routine.
  • Use Adhesives if Necessary – Denture adhesives can provide extra stability, especially during the initial adjustment phase.
  • Attend Regular Dental Check-Ups – Routine dental visits ensure that your dentures remain in good condition and fit properly over time.
